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to go to court for this matter?
Court involvement is a real possibility in disputes matters, particularly when disagreements escalate or parties cannot reach agreement through negotiation. Whether your situation requires a court appearance depends on several factors: the nature of the dispute, its complexity, the jurisdiction involved, and how willing all parties are to resolve matters outside formal proceedings. Some disputes are settled through negotiation or alternative dispute resolution, whilst others may necessitate court action. Based on your location in Wilston, QLD, one nearby court location is: Brisbane Magistrates Court 240 Roma Street, Brisbane City This location is provided for general context only. Disputes matters are generally handled in the Magistrates Court or District Court depending on the claim amount and complexity of the issues involved. A lawyer can advise whether court involvement is required and which court or tribunal applies to your situation.

How much do Disputes lawyers cost in Wilston, QLD?
Disputes lawyers in Wilston, QLD generally charge between $450 and $900 per hour, with rates varying based on the lawyer's experience, location and firm size. Total costs depend significantly on the time required for your particular matter. Simple disputes involving basic contract advice or straightforward debt recovery typically require fewer hours and fall at the lower end of the cost spectrum. Medium complexity matters such as commercial disagreements or partnership disputes sit in the mid-range, whilst complex litigation requiring extensive court appearances, expert witnesses, and detailed case preparation command the higher rates and result in substantially greater total costs.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What documents do I need for a Disputes lawyer in Wilston, QLD?
Having documentation organised before meeting a disputes lawyer can streamline your consultation significantly. Gather photo ID, any contracts or agreements relevant to your dispute, correspondence between parties (emails, letters, text messages), and financial records if money is involved. Court documents from existing proceedings, if available, help lawyers assess your situation quickly. When property disputes arise, title deeds or lease agreements prove valuable, whilst employment-related conflicts benefit from contracts, pay slips, and termination correspondence. Only a lawyer can confirm what documents are required for your situation. Some Australia Post offices offer services like certified copies, photo ID, or printing.
